Job Purpose

This position is currently grant-funded through pe r-member-per month payments tied to contracts between Medicaid, insurance companies, and local health departments. At this time, funding is secured through December 31, 2026. Join a mission-driven team making a real impact in Alamance County. Responsibilities

Provide comprehensive CMHRP Care Management services for pregnant Medicaid members who are at risk for poor birth outcomes. In this role, you will assess, plan, coordinate, and evaluate care while offering support to meet the medical, preventive, and social needs of pregnant and postpartum women. You will connect patients with medical, nutritional, educational, social, and emotional resources to promote healthy pregnancies and positive birth outcomes.

Responsibilities include clinic, community, physician office, and home visits to meet program requirements. You will serve as part of a multidisciplinary Care Management Team—providing leadership for medically complex patients and acting as a nursing resource for non-nurse team members. You will work toward program goals established by the State Medicaid program and prepaid health plans. Additional duties include using multiple electronic medical record systems, reviewing and reporting program data, assisting with staff onboarding and training, and supporting student learners.

This position also provides direct supervision for 3.5 multidisciplinary team members.
